Chad Lee was a 2012 Republican candidate who sought election to the U.S. House representing the 2nd Congressional District of Wisconsin. He lost to Democratic opponent Mark Pocan.[1]

Biography

Lee earned his undergraduate degree in Business Administration from Olivet Nazarene University. He has his insurance license and has started and sold a residential and commercial cleaning firm.[2]

Elections

2012

See also: Wisconsin's 2nd congressional district elections, 2012

Lee ran in the 2012 election for the U.S. House, representing Wisconsin's 2nd District. He sought the nomination on the Republican ticket[3] and was unopposed in the Republican primary.[4]

U.S. House, Wisconsin, District 2 General Election, 2012
Party Candidate Vote % Votes
     Democratic Green check mark.jpgMark Pocan 67.9% 265,422
     Republican Chad Lee 31.9% 124,683
     Independent Joe Kopsick 0% 6
     Miscellaneous N/A 0.2% 787
Total Votes 390,898
Source: Wisconsin Government Accountability Board "Official Election Results, 2012 General Election"

Campaign donors

2012

Breakdown of the source of Lee's campaign funds before the 2012 election.

Lee lost election to the U.S. House in 2012. During that election cycle, Lee's campaign committee raised a total of $91,144 and spent $90,316.[5]
